在现代企业管理中,ERP系统扮演着至关重要的角色。其中,附件管理模块作为ERP系统的重要组成部分,不仅提高了文件管理的效率,还增强了数据的安全性和可追溯性。本文将深入解析ERP系统附件管理模块的核心功能与技术架构。
附件管理模块的核心功能主要围绕文件的存储、检索、共享和安全展开。文件存储功能确保所有相关文档能够被集中存储在ERP系统中,便于统一管理和备份。检索功能允许用户通过关键词、文件类型、创建日期等多种方式快速找到所需文件,极大提高了工作效率。共享功能则使得团队成员能够轻松访问和协作处理文件,不受地理位置的限制。安全功能通过权限控制和审计跟踪,确保文件的安全性和合规性。
技术架构方面,附件管理模块通常采用多层架构设计,以确保系统的灵活性和可扩展性。在数据层,模块会与数据库紧密集成,以存储文件的元数据和实际内容。元数据包括文件名、创建者、创建时间等信息,而文件内容则可能存储在数据库中,或者通过链接指向外部存储系统,如云存储服务。这种设计有助于优化存储空间的使用,并提高数据访问速度。
在业务逻辑层,附件管理模块会实现文件的上传、下载、删除等操作,并处理权限验证和审计日志的记录。这一层通常使用服务导向架构(SOA)来实现,以便于与其他ERP模块进行交互和集成。服务层会提供API接口,供前端应用调用,实现用户界面与后端服务的解耦。
用户界面层则负责提供直观的操作界面,让用户能够轻松地进行文件管理。这一层通常会采用现代的前端技术栈,如React或Vue.js,以提供流畅的用户体验。同时,界面设计需考虑到不同用户角色的需求,提供定制化的视图和操作选项。
附件管理模块的技术架构还必须考虑到性能和可靠性。因此,模块会采用缓存机制来减少数据库的访问压力,并通过负载均衡和数据库复制等技术来提高系统的可用性和容错能力。
ERP系统附件管理模块通过其核心功能和多层技术架构,为企业提供了一个高效、安全且易于使用的文件管理解决方案。这种模块的设计和实现,不仅优化了文件处理流程,还加强了企业数据的整体管理能力。
文章推荐: